Frequently Asked Questions about Bellaire
How much are Studio apartments in Bellaire?
There are currently 95 Studio Apartments in Bellaire with rent ranges from $745 to $5,249 with an average price of $1,224.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bellaire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bellaire ranges from $569 to $9,229 with an average monthly rent of $1,394.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bellaire c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bellaire range from $683 to $8,901.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,891.
How expensive are Bellaire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 115 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bellaire on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$875 to $16,019 - averaging $2,668 for the location.
